Next up sees Gatecrasher favourites Agnelli & Nelson, who have been in the music industry together since 1997. Their massive Balaeric hits such as ‘El Nino’ and ‘Everyday’ have helped define the sound of the Ibiza party spirit and have become firm classics with the Gatecrasher crowd. Their most recent track ‘Holding onto Nothing’ was championed by the likes of Oakenfold and Paul van Dyk who made a special re-rub of the track for his own Vandit imprint. On the DJ front, these guys have been in the industry for so long but have yet to retire and are still spinning throughout the world and amazing crowds from the U.S to Japan.

Next on deck duty will see Richard Durand who is without doubt one of the hottest new trance DJ / Producer to emerge from Holland this past year. Recommended by Tiesto as ‘Tip For The Top in 2007’, Richard has responded with a string of stunning productions and remixes in recent months, including reworks of Tiesto’s ‘Lethal Industry’, ‘Flight 643’ and ‘Break My Fall’ and his solo tech trance bombs such as ‘Make Me Scream’ and ‘Slipping Away’. Not content with only being one of the most in demand producers on the planet, Richard Durand is one of the most technically accomplished DJs n dance music today. The proof of Richard’s show-stopping sets and crowd pulling DJ status is confirmed by a DJ diary that has exploded due to demand playing at high profile shows and festival appearances, such as Dance Valley, Planet Love, Coloursfest amongst many others, thus culminating in Richard Durand rising to No. 66 in the DJ Magazine Top 100 poll in 2008.
